A group of top Canadian tour operators and travel agents – all specialists in group tours and responsible for making the travel arrangements for a diverse range of large groups – has been visiting Ireland. They were here as guests of Tourism Ireland, Fáilte Ireland and Tourism NI.

The tour operators and travel agents are pictured with with Jonathan Sargeant, Tourism Ireland (front, left), at Listoke Distillery & Gin School in Drogheda, during a demonstration with ?co-founder Bronagh Conlon (front, centre).
The Canadians attended a ‘Canadian Expo’ B2B workshop in Cavan – organised by Fáilte Ireland – where they met with Irish tourism enterprises to negotiate for their 2018 programmes. They also undertook an action-packed fact-finding visit – taking in places like Titanic Belfast, the Giant's Causeway, Glenveagh Castle, Lissadell House and Gardens, Carlingford Design House, Listoke Distillery & Gin School and Malahide Castle.
Dana Welch, Tourism Ireland’s Manager in Canada, said: “Tourism Ireland was delighted to invite these top Canadian tour operators and travel agents to visit the island of Ireland, to see and experience some of our many great attractions and to encourage them to include Ireland in their programmes for 2018.”
